Propagation of Intense Femtosecond Laser Pulses in Ar Gas and Ar Clusters
The propagation of intense femtosecond laser pulses(50 fs,10 16 w/cm2) in Ar gas and middle-size Ar clusters is modelled by solving 3D propagation equation numerically.The results show that the intense femtosecond laser pulses propagating in Ar gas will experience ionization-induced modulations, including spectral blueshifting and beam refraction,while self-focusing may occur for the intense femtosecond laser pulses propagating in Ar clusters.
